Defence Ministry continues providing Military with housing

The Defence Ministry of Georgia continues to improve the social conditions for military servicemen. 17 more military families received new flats in the Varketili Military Town.

Defence Minister Irakli Alasania, his Deputy Vako Avaliani and Chief of General Staff of GAF, Major-General Vakhtang Kapanadze, visited the Varketili settlement. They personally gave the keys to the family of Georgian soldier, I Class Private Zurab Gurgenashvili fallen in the ISAF mission and Sergeant Avtandil Jakelidze heavily wounded in the August War 2008. Later, the top brass of the Defence Ministry viewed the new accommodations and congratulated their owners on receiving the flats.

“We’ve taken commitment to assist our military servicemen to be socially secured. They are carrying out the most important work for our country – they defend our homeland, Georgia’s international image and fulfill international commitments undertaken by Georgia,” stated Defence Minister Irakli Alasania.

In total, 14 families of soldiers fallen in the ISAF mission in Afghanistan and OIF in Iraq missions, as well as 5 military servicemen heavily wounded in the August War 2008 received new flats in the Varketili Settlement. The flats were repaired according to a special project for wounded soldiers and are equipped with the infrastructure according to their physical condition.

Under the decision of the Georgian Government, military servicemen and their families were handed new flats at a symbolic price through direct sales, at the address of No.3 Abashvili St., Tbilisi.

As a result of the coordination work among the Ministries of Defence, Justice and Economy, according to the decision of Georgian Government, each relevant document was legally regulated and prepared. New owners received flats with all legal norms and procedures. Construction work will be continued in the Varketili Military town this year and 260 more military servicemen will receive new accommodations there.
